+/*
+ * this element defines a buffer that is allocated and mapped into gpu address
+ * space. data_byte_offset defines the beginning of the buffer inside the
+ * firmare. num_bytes defines how many bytes the firmware contains.
+ *
+ * If data_byte_offset is zero, we allocate an empty buffer.
+ */
+
+struct gk20a_cde_hdr_buf {
+ u64 data_byte_offset;
+ u64 num_bytes;
+};
+
+/*
+ * this element defines a constant patching in buffers. It basically
+ * computes physical address to +source_byte_offset. The
+ * address is then modified into patch value as per:
+ * value = (current_value & ~mask) | (address << shift) & mask .
+ *
+ * The type field defines the register size as:
+ * 0=u32,
+ * 1=u64 (little endian),
+ * 2=u64 (big endian)
+ */
+
+struct gk20a_cde_hdr_replace {
+ u32 target_buf;
+ u32 source_buf;
+ s32 shift;
+ u32 type;
+ s64 target_byte_offset;
+ s64 source_byte_offset;
+ u64 mask;
+};
+
+enum {
+ TYPE_PARAM_TYPE_U32 = 0,
+ TYPE_PARAM_TYPE_U64_LITTLE,
+ TYPE_PARAM_TYPE_U64_BIG
+};
+
+/*
+ * this element defines a runtime patching in buffers. Parameters with id from
+ * 0 to 1024 are reserved for special usage as follows:
+ * 0 = comptags_per_cacheline,
+ * 1 = slices_per_fbp,
+ * 2 = num_fbps
+ * 3 = source buffer first page offset
+ * 4 = source buffer block height log2
+ * 5 = backing store memory address
+ * 6 = destination memory address
+ * 7 = destination size (bytes)
+ * 8 = backing store size (bytes)
+ * 9 = cache line size
+ *
+ * Parameters above id 1024 are user-specified. I.e. they determine where a
+ * parameters from user space should be placed in buffers, what is their
+ * type, etc.
+ *
+ * Once the value is available, we add data_offset to the value.
+ *
+ * The value address is then modified into patch value as per:
+ * value = (current_value & ~mask) | (address << shift) & mask .
+ *
+ * The type field defines the register size as:
+ * 0=u32,
+ * 1=u64 (little endian),
+ * 2=u64 (big endian)
+ */
